Puncte:0

Kafka - Obțineți adresa IP sau numele de gazdă conectate la cluster

drapel bd

Am un cluster Kafka de testare în AWS MSK cu trei brokeri. Aș dori să știu cum să obțin informații despre cine se conectează la cluster fie pentru a produce, fie pentru a consuma mesaje.

De exemplu, MSSQL Server înregistrează conexiuni reușite:

Conectarea a reușit pentru utilizatorul „sa”. Conexiune realizată folosind autentificarea SQL Server. [CLIENT: 192.XX.X.XX]

Există vreo modalitate în Kafka de a ști cine se conectează și de unde?

Mulțumesc anticipat.

Puncte:0
drapel ar

Afara din cutie...

Producători - nu este posibil

Consumatorii – utilizare kafka-grupuri-de-consumatori --descrie peste toate ID-urile de grup și analizați rezultatul pentru a obține ID-urile clientului.


Acest lucru nu vă împiedică să adăugați soluții de urmărire distribuite care pot urmări conexiunile la serverul client Kafka (și să vedeți cu ce subiecte interacționează)

Luis de Haro avatar
drapel bd
Mulțumesc! - vreo soluție specială de urmărire pe care ați recomanda-o?
drapel ar
Începeți aici - https://www.confluent.io/blog/importance-of-distributed-tracing-for-apache-kafka-based-applications/

Postează un răspuns

Majoritatea oamenilor nu înțeleg că a pune multe întrebări deblochează învățarea și îmbunătățește legătura interpersonală. În studiile lui Alison, de exemplu, deși oamenii își puteau aminti cu exactitate câte întrebări au fost puse în conversațiile lor, ei nu au intuit legătura dintre întrebări și apreciere. În patru studii, în care participanții au fost implicați în conversații ei înșiși sau au citit transcrieri ale conversațiilor altora, oamenii au avut tendința să nu realizeze că întrebarea ar influența – sau ar fi influențat – nivelul de prietenie dintre conversatori.